Are you a seasoned Property Manager based in London with a passion for excellence and a knack for overseeing large residential portfolios? Our esteemed client, a high-end Property Management firm, is in search of a highly skilled and experienced professional to manage an extensive portfolio of residential properties, including several blocks of flats. This role offers the chance to work with a prestigious company that values expertise, dedication, and a proactive approach. The successful candidate will enjoy a dynamic work environment, opportunities for professional growth, and the satisfaction of maintaining high standards in property management. Key Responsibilities: – Oversee all building management operations, ensuring compliance with health, safety, and statutory regulations. – Investigate and respond to escalated tenant complaints, while leading a team of customer service administrators to resolve issues efficiently and professionally. – Review and action various risk assessments (FRA, LRA, HSRA), ensuring risks are identified and mitigated, and appoint qualified contractors for corrective works. – Manage void repairs, ensuring vacant units are maintained and prepared for new tenant check-ins. – Control budgets for property repairs and maintenance, ensuring expenditures remain within approved limits. – Conduct regular property inspections, promptly addressing maintenance issues. Qualifications and Experience: Essential: – Minimum of 3 years’ experience in a property management role, specifically managing a large residential portfolio. – Strong understanding and demonstrable competence in building management, including maintenance, repairs, and building systems. – Ability to handle urgent issues and emergencies effectively. – Proven expertise in delivering exceptional customer service and maintaining strong tenant relationships. – In-depth knowledge of health and safety regulations, building compliance, and risk management in line with PAS 8673:2022. – Experience managing high-rise residential properties and working knowledge of the Building Safety Act 2022. – A proactive and organised approach with the ability to prioritise tasks and manage a busy workload. – Proficiency in Microsoft Office. Desirable: – Relevant property management qualifications (e.g., ARLA, TPI, NEBOSH, RICS). – Knowledge of property management software and systems: Rightmove, On the Market, Zoopla, Arthur, Fixflo. – Experience in managing a team.
